WebConsular identification (CID) cards are issued by some governments to their citizens who are living in foreign countries. They may be used, for example, by an embassy to allow its citizens to vote in a foreign country. Some jurisdictions accept them … WebHow do I obtain a consular ID card? Contact your local consulate to find out if they offer consular ID cards. Some consulates offer the option to apply by mail, but most require the applicant to obtain an appointment and visit their offices in person. WebThe matrícula consular can be a valuable identification card for Mexicans living in the United States. Several U.S. states, municipalities, and businesses accept the card as an official form of identification.
